America has been waiting to hear George and Cindy Anthony’s side of the story — and soon enough, we will. The couple will appear on the Sept. 12 premiere of “Dr. Phil” and in a promo clip released, the TV doc really grills the grieving grandparents, whose daughter Casey Anthony was acquitted last month for murdering her two-year-old daughter Caylee. “I want you to answer my questions, tell the truth once and for all,” charges Dr. Phil in the teaser for the face-to-face interview. “America’s never heard of this explanation before. Why have you sat on this information?” McGraw is shown later asking, although it’s not clear if the question is directed at the Anthonys, who don’t speak in the 30-second clip, or if it’s in reference to Casey’s defense. During the opening arguments at her murder trial, the now-25-year-old’s lawyer dropped the bomb that Caylee had drowned in the family’s pool, but Casey was too afraid to admit it, so she made up the story that the child’s supposed nanny had kidnapped her. Caylee’s badly decomposed body was discovered not far from the Anthony’s Orlando, Fla., home in December 2008, six months after she was last seen alive. Throughout the entire ordeal, George and Cindy had maintained their daughter’s innocence, especially Cindy. “There are millions of people who want to shake you awake,” Dr. Phil says to her in the promo. He then turns to George, whom Casey’s lawyer Jose Baez accused of molesting his daughter during opening statements. Baez also claimed that George was home at the time of Caylee’s drowning and that he helped his daughter cover it up. “You know the truth, don’t you?” Dr. Phil asks George, but it cuts off before he answers. The Anthonys have had no contact with their daughter since her release from prison. Casey is currently back in Orlando, where she must serve a one-year probation for a charge separate from her daughter’s death. NY Daily News
